financial disassociation for BR

Hi- i hope this is in the right place.

I had a thread before about going bankrupt and some very helpful souls suggested i needed to financially disassociate myself from my OH before going bankrupt and gave me a link about how to do so. But i was wondering if i could get some comments about my disassociation letter. Should both myself and my OH send the letters to the 3 credit reference agencies and what sort of reply should i expect??

so far i've got;


To Whom It May Concern,
I am writing in order to financially disassociate myself from ***********, with whom I have previously had two joint accounts. Both accounts have since been closed and I have enclosed proof that they are no longer existing accounts.
The first is a HSBC joint current account, for which I enclose the closing statement. The second is an ABBEY joint current account, for which I enclose a letter sent to me by ABBEY which states that the account has been closed.
I would be very grateful if a Notice of Disassociation could be place on my credit files.

    I rang experian and they got me to fill an online form in. They have now processed the disassociation and advised the other agencies.

    Callcredit have sent us a form to fill them- then apparently they do all the running work to check we're not telling porkies & then they inform the other credit reference agencies. The other two haven't replied to the letters yet though.
